Report ID: SPE000000060840, U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s

Reported Entity: VISN 23 Minneapolis, MN

Issue:

An Employee/Veteran questioned the validity of a clinic supervisor having a business reason for going into his medical record. Update: 04/15/11:During the audit of this record it was discovered a coworker inappropriately accessed the record. The medical record includes name, full SSN, date of birth and protected health information. The Employee/Veteran will receive a letter offering credit protection services.

Outcome:

Sent to HRMS for disciplinary action. Employee will be required to retake Privacy Training again immediately upon receiving HR letter.
